Decipher Your Partner's Love Language

In the intricate amor propio tapestry of relationships, understanding your partner's love language can unfold a world of deeper connection. Love languages, popularized by Dr. Gary Chapman, are the ways in which individuals receive and understand love. By recognizing your significant other's primary love language, you can communicate in a way that truly resonates with them, cultivating your bond.

  • copyright of affirmation are for those who flourish on verbal expressions of love, such as compliments, encouragement, and loving copyright.
  • Expressions of service speak to individuals who feel most loved through tangible acts of help and support.
  • Receiving gifts is a love language for those who appreciate thoughtful presents that express your love and care.
  • Meaningful time signifies the importance of undivided attention and shared experiences for individuals with this love language.
  • Physical touch is a love language for those who feel comforted by physical closeness, such as hugs, kisses, and holding hands.

Learning your partner's love language can be a truly transformative journey in your relationship. By recognizing their needs and showing affection in ways that resonate with them, you can foster a deeper sense of love and create a lasting bond built on mutual understanding and appreciation.

Navigating Conflicts with Compassion

When issues arise, it's easy to become caught up in the heat of the moment. However, approaching these situations with compassion can make a difference in mitigating the conflict. Start with listening to the other person's perspective without becoming resistant. Validate their feelings, even if you don't agree them. This demonstrates respect and can help create a safer environment for conversation.

  • Bear in that everyone has unique experiences and perspectives. What might seem logical to you may not be the same for someone else.
  • Aim for common ground by dwelling on shared goals or values.
  • Stay open to negotiation. It's unlikely that one person will get everything they want, so adaptability is essential.

By embracing compassion in conflict situations, you can build healthier relationships and create a more supportive environment for everyone involved.

Building a Strong Foundation: Communication Tips for Couples

Open and honest communication is the bedrock of any healthy relationship. When you cultivate a space where both partners feel comfortable sharing their thoughts and feelings, it strengthens the emotional link. Active listening is crucial; truly focus to what your partner is saying, not just waiting for your turn to speak. Validate their emotions, even if you don't always comprehend.

A honest way of communicating your own needs and feelings can prevent misunderstandings. Use "I" statements instead of blaming or critical language. For example, instead of saying "You always make me feel disrespected", try "I perceive unimportant when..."

Consistently checking in with each other can help keep communication flowing smoothly. Make time for dedicated conversations where you can both share your day, thoughts, and dreams.
